Name one safety feature of modern gas appliances.

  1. Flame thrower

  2. Thermostatic control

  3. Oxygen depletion sensor

  4. Cross-contamination filter

The correct answer is: Oxygen depletion sensor

One important safety feature of modern gas appliances is the oxygen depletion sensor. This device plays a critical role in ensuring the safe operation of gas appliances. It continuously monitors the level of oxygen in the environment where the appliance operates. When it detects a drop in oxygen levels, which could indicate potentially dangerous conditions or inadequate ventilation, the sensor automatically shuts off the gas supply to the appliance. This helps prevent hazardous situations, such as carbon monoxide buildup, which can occur in areas where ventilation is insufficient, offering a layer of safety for users. Other options such as a flame thrower and cross-contamination filter do not serve a direct safety purpose in gas appliances, while thermostatic control is more aimed at regulating temperature rather than ensuring safety during operation.
